I'm trying to convert my dvr-ed movies into an mp4 container using the mkvtool gui. While the transcoding process seems to work well, I've noticed that the mp4 output files now have black borders on the top and bottom part of the screen which weren't present in the source file. Any idea how I might get rid of those borders as I'm just using the pass thru option for the h.264 video track?

How are you viewing your mp4 file? If you're passing through the video, it's impossible for permanent black borders to be added to the video. It would involve the creation of "black pixels" to form the borders, which could only happen if the video is re-encoded. Even if you were re-encoding, no borders should be created. It would be a waste of pixels. Then again, I've learned that impossible sometimes does happen .
What might be happening is that the pixel aspect ratio information has been messed up, so your TV or whatever viewing device your using is displaying the video with letterboxing. A settings change on your TV might fix things up. You could also use MKVtools to change the pixel aspect ratio of the mp4 file. You also could try the latest beta of MKVtools which does a better job with pixel aspect ratios.
Just thinking outside of the box, perhaps you're original has the black borders and there is a flag that tells the video player not to show them. That flag could be lost when converting to mp4. I've never heard of this, but then there are a whole bunch of things that I've never heard of .
